PM Kisan Samman Nidhi: After taking the oath as Prime Minister for the third consecutive time, PM Modi has taken a big decision regarding the farmers of the country. PM Modi has signed the file for the release of the installment of Kisan Samman Nidhi on Monday, June 10, 2024.

Farmers are eagerly waiting for the 17th installment of the PM Kisan Nidhi Yojana. News agency ANI reported that more than 9.3 crore farmers will benefit from this move. With this, more than Rs 20,000 crore will be distributed.

What is the PM Kisan Samman Nidhi Yojana?

Under the PM Kisan Samman Nidhi Yojana, farmers are given an annual assistance of Rs 6 thousand by the government. This money goes directly to the bank accounts of the beneficiaries.

Farmers are given three installments of Rs 2000 every four months. PM Modi took his oath for the third term on June 9 after being elected the leader of the NDA parliamentary party.
